Book Description

October 1990 1555601324 978-1555601324 Game
DMZ is a game of street combat set in the near future. Quick combat-resolution and movement systems make battles move along, whether the fight is on motorcycles or on foot, whether it is fought with magic, automatic weapons, or bare fists. DMZ is a great introduction to the Shadowrun universe, and will stand alone as a board game, or can be used to resolve large-scale gang and street combats in the Shadowrun roleplaying game.

3.0 out of 5 stars Doesn't really fit with the rest of the universe..., June 11, 1998
By A Customer
This review is from: D.M.Z.: Downtown Militarized Zone (Shadowrun) (Hardcover)
I didn't really like this set because it doesn't fit in very well with the rest of the Shadowrun game universe, particularly if you are running SR2. (if you aren't, you are the last of a dying breed.) In addition, the emphasis is on really fast combat, nothing else. Hey, if I've got my characters in a nasty firefight, I want to play the whole thing out, not go through some fast resolution thing. As for the other people involved in combat that are not directly affecting the PCs? As a GM, you should be able to arbitrarily make decisions, and not have to use a completely different set of rules to determine the outcome of every single shot fired. The one redeeming value that this has is the cool overhead maps and the character cutouts- you can use them to represent the bad guys in a fight when you don't have enough regular minatures to go around. The overheads add a nice graphic touch to the regular layouts. Summation- nice if you can get it, but avoid paying list price for it.
